What is the difference between puppy and junior food?

Puppy and junior food are both formulated for growing dogs. All puppies once weaned at around 6-7 weeks should be fed on James Wellbeloved puppy food. Depending on the adult size of the dog your puppy may benefit from being fed a junior food designed as a follow on food for medium and large breed dogs. It’s all to do with the age at which dogs mature For example small dogs will be mature at 6 months and can gradually move onto their own small breed adult food then; whilst large dogs will continue to grow well into their second year and will benefit from being fed a large breed junior food.
